The basic healthy wrap recipe

To avoid store-bought wraps — which often contain unnecessary amounts of sugar, salt, fat and additives — we suggest making your own with this simple recipe.

Ingredients (makes 2 wraps):

  • 180 g semi-wholemeal spelt flour (or flour of your choice)
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 90 g water
  • 1 pinch of your favourite spices
  • ½ tsp bicarbonate of soda

Method:

Place the flour, olive oil, water, spices and bicarbonate of soda in a bowl and mix by hand until you have a smooth, even dough. Divide the dough in two and roll each half into a ball.

Flour your work surface and roll out the first dough ball with a rolling pin to form a round. Turn the wrap regularly and add more flour as needed to prevent it from sticking.

Roll the dough out until you have circles about 2 mm thick. Heat a non-stick pan. Carefully place the wrap in the pan and cook for 30 seconds on each side. Repeat with the second dough ball.

Chicken curry wrap

wrap-poulet-curryIngredients (makes 2 wraps):

  • 2 wraps
  • 200 g diced chicken
  • 200 g lettuce
  • 2 small tomatoes
  • 1 bell pepper
  • 2 tablespoons fromage blanc (or plain low-fat yogurt)
  • 1 pinch of curry powder

Method:

Start by cooking the diced chicken in a pan. Towards the end of cooking, add the fromage blanc and curry powder and mix well.

Slice the tomato thinly and dice the bell pepper, then fill the wraps with the lettuce. Add the chicken, bell pepper and tomato slices. Roll the wraps up firmly so they hold their shape, then wrap them in cling film and refrigerate. Enjoy them fresh at lunchtime!

Salmon wraps

Ingredients (makes 2 wraps):

  • 2 wraps
  • 2 large lettuce leaves
  • 2 slices of smoked salmon
  • 2 portions of cream cheese spread
  • ½ organic lemon
  • ½ cucumber

Method:

Start by spreading a portion of cream cheese over each wrap.

Place a lettuce leaf on each wrap, then a slice of smoked salmon.

Gently squeeze the lemon over the tortillas to add a few drops of lemon juice.

Peel the cucumber then cut it into sticks. Divide them between the 2 wraps.

Gently roll up your wraps and wrap them in aluminium foil to keep their shape and make them easy to enjoy on the go.

Healthy chicken and vegetable wrap

Ingredients (makes 2 wraps):

  • 1 chicken breast
  • ½ red bell pepper
  • ½ green bell pepper
  • ½ onion
  • juice of 1 lemon
  • 1 tsp cumin
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p red wine vinegar

Method:

Slice the onion and bell peppers into strips. In a non-stick pan, sauté the onions. Add the vinegar and let the onions caramelise over medium heat, stirring frequently. Add the bell peppers, garlic and spices and cook for a few minutes, adding a splash of water if needed.

Cut the chicken into small pieces and cook in the pan, then add the lemon juice towards the end of cooking. Leave to cook over very low heat for a few more minutes.

Meanwhile, dice the tomatoes.

On a wrap, layer the vegetable mix, the chicken and then the tomato. Fold and enjoy!

Grisons beef and spinach wrap

Ingredients (makes 2 wraps):

  • 2 wraps
  • 8 thin slices of Grisons beef (Bündnerfleisch)
  • 2 handfuls of baby spinach
  • 2 portions of fat-free cream cheese
  • A little dried oregano
  • Espelette pepper

Method:

Start by spreading cream cheese over the wraps, then season to taste with the spices.

Place 4 slices of Grisons beef on each wrap, then add a handful of baby spinach.

Roll everything up and enjoy!
